PDA

View Full Version : sliding menu



momayyezi_m
چهارشنبه 14 خرداد 1393, 17:28 عصر
http://u.cubeupload.com/saeidq8/13COSlidingMenup.gif
سلام در مورد این نمونه برای اینکه با کلیک بر روی هر کدام از آیتم های منوهای سمت چپ و راست یه کدی اجرا بشه... برای این کار چه کدی لازمه




lvLeft.setAdapter(new ArrayAdapter<String>(this, R.layout.item, R.id.tv_item, title));
lvLeft.setOnItemClickListener(new OnItemClickListener() {

@Override
public void onItemClick(AdapterView<?> arg0, View arg1, int arg2, long arg3) {

Log.d(TAG, "点ه‡»ن؛†ه·¦è¾¹çڑ„" + arg2);

switch ( arg2) {
case 0:
Toast.makeText(MainActivity.this, "1", 1000);
break;
case 1:
Toast.makeText(MainActivity.this, "2", 1000);
break;

}
}
});


من اومدم switch گذاشتم ولی کار نمیکنه ...چی کار باید بکنم

mfaridi
چهارشنبه 14 خرداد 1393, 18:50 عصر
اگه منظورت جابجای بین اکتیویتی هست از این کد استفاده کن
Intent intent=new Intent(getApplicationContext(), Activity2.class);
startActivity(new Intent(intent));

momayyezi_m
چهارشنبه 14 خرداد 1393, 20:42 عصر
نه منظورم این نیست
پست اول رو ویرایش کردم و منظورم رو دقیق رسوندم ممنون میشم راهنماییم کنید

mfaridi
پنج شنبه 15 خرداد 1393, 02:20 صبح
خوب این دقیقا همون کلیک روی لیست هست هیچ فرقی نداره فقط دوتا لیست داری یکی لیست سمت راست یکی سمت چپ پس دوتا میسازی اگه با کلیک روی ایتمش مشکل داری بگو

momayyezi_m
پنج شنبه 15 خرداد 1393, 09:43 صبح
کد نویسی switch رو درست نوشته بودم ولی یه جا دیگه اشتباه بود اونم این که یادم رفته بود اخر کد توست
.show() رو بنویسم :لبخند::خجالت: